Job Description
The Six String Grill is a distinguished restaurant offering a unique dining experience with a full bar and a menu that features exceptional burgers, salads, steaks, and a variety of original desserts. Located within the exclusive Hill Country Golf & Guitar resort, this establishment combines quality food with entertainment, including a premium mini-golf experience beneath a roaring waterfall and live music. The venue is a vibrant and authentic destination for the greater Austin community, where patrons come together to enjoy delicious food, premium beverages, and memorable social events in an inviting atmosphere. The Six String Grill has carefully crafted a masterful menu that caters both to the discriminating foodie and casual bar and grill guests, creating an inclusive yet refined dining environment.
Currently, The Six String Grill is seeking to expand its dessert offerings by incorporating signature seasonal pies, cakes, and other creative and original desserts on a monthly basis. The dessert menu as it stands includes standout items such as Key Lime Pie, Espresso Cream Cake, and Cheesecake—all indicative of the culinary creativity nurtured within the kitchen. The Pastry Chef will play a pivotal role in driving this initiative, leading the pastry and baking functions with a focus on innovation, quality, and consistency.
In this role, the Pastry Chef will manage all aspects of the dessert kitchen operations, including menu development, inventory management, purchasing, and cost control. They will be responsible for crafting dessert menus that optimize profits while minimizing waste, ensuring that every offering aligns with the restaurant’s high standards and guest expectations. The position requires an individual who understands federal, state, and local food sanitation regulations to maintain a clean and safe kitchen environment. As a crucial member of the culinary team, the Pastry Chef must be proactive in reducing waste and managing supplies efficiently.
This opportunity offers a flexible part-time schedule, approximately 24 to 32 hours per week, with working hours adjusted to suit the restaurant’s needs. The ability to effectively produce high-quality desserts to serve a substantial volume of guests—up to 8,000 patrons per month—is essential. This role not only demands technical baking and pastry skills but also an innovative mindset to help the kitchen evolve its dessert offerings and maintain a competitive edge in Austin’s dynamic food scene.
Working at The Six String Grill means contributing to a unique establishment that elevates the dining and entertainment experience. Here, mini-golf is paired with a sophisticated food and beverage menu, creating a space where adults, teens, college students, and families alike can enjoy premium wines, local live music, and memorable moments. The Hill Country Golf & Guitar, including The Six String Grill, embodies the Austin spirit—an authentic community hub that strives to make every visit feel like coming home. As part of this team, the Pastry Chef will play an integral role in fulfilling that mission through culinary excellence and community engagement.
